I colori:

blu

viola

azzurro

verde

giallo

arancione

rosa

rosso

marrone

bianco

grigio

nero


Three of the colors are always the same: "blu","rosa", "viola".

Modify with chiaro (light) and scuro (dark).


Ex:

Blue skies - Cieli blu

Light blue skies - Cieli azzurri
